About Ho Chi Minh House
Ho Chi Minh House matters because it prevents Nakhon Phanom's Vietnamese story from staying abstract. Once you see it inside the city-core route, the food, the memorial clock tower, and the broader Mekong-border history start to connect in a more concrete way. It works best as part of a heritage-and-food block, not as a separate deep-history detour. That keeps the stop useful for most travelers without pretending the city needs an oversized museum itinerary.

Cultural Importance
Ho Chi Minh House helps explain why Vietnamese influence in Nakhon Phanom is still visible in both heritage stops and the city's food identity.
What to Expect
Expect a compact heritage stop rather than a long museum day. The real value is in how it sharpens the rest of the city: the Vietnamese Memorial Clock Tower, nearby food planning, and the wider sense that Nakhon Phanom is not only a scenic river town.
